XL2600_US-Sp.book Page 24 Thursday, November 4, 2004 11:41 AM KNOWING YOUR SEWING MACHINE / CONOZCA SU MÁQUINA DE COSER ————————————————————————————— CAUTION/PRECAUCIÓN Stitch Length Dial Control de longitud de puntada ● If the stitches are bunched together, Depending on the selected stitch, you may need to adjust the stitch length for best results. The numbers marked on the stitch length dial represent the stitch length in millimeters (mm) (1/25 inch). THE HIGHER THE NUMBER, THE LONGER THE STITCH.

XL2600_US-Sp.book Page 38 Thursday, November 4, 2004 11:41 AM KNOWING YOUR SEWING MACHINE / CONOZCA SU MÁQUINA DE COSER ————————————————————————————— ■ Upper Tension is too Tight El hilo superior está demasiado tenso Loops will appear on the surface of the fabric. Thread Tension Tensión del hilo The tension of the thread will affect the quality of your stitches. You may need to adjust it when you change fabric or thread. XL2600_US-Sp.book Page 49 Thursday, November 4, 2004 11:41 AM You can use these stitches to join together seams and finish them in one operation. The Overlock Stitches are also useful for sewing stretch materials while the Arrowhead Stitch is ideal for sewing the edge of a blanket.
